      TZUTC: -0400       MSGID: 53524.fido-cooking@1:3634/12 2d349194       PID: Synchronet 3.18a-Linux May 23 2020 GCC 7.5.0       TID: SBBSecho 3.11-Linux r3.173 May 23 2020 GCC 7.5.0       CHRS: ASCII 1       M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06                Title: Chicken & Onion Caesar Salad        Categories: Poultry, Vegetables, Cheese, Potatoes        Yield: 2 Servings                1/2 lb Boned, skinned chicken; in        - 1" pieces        1 lg Sweet onion; in 2" pieces        6 tb Creamy Caesar salad        - dressing; divided        4 sm Red potatoes; halved        1/2 ts Lemon juice        1/8 ts Coarse ground pepper        1 sm Bunch romaine; torn        2 tb Shredded Parmesan cheese                In a large bowl, combine chicken, onion and 2 tb salad        dressing; toss to coat. In a small bowl, combine potatoes        with 2 tb salad dressing.                Alternately thread chicken & onion onto metal or soaked        wooden skewers, leaving space between each piece. Thread        potatoes onto separate metal o soaked wooden skewers.                On a greased grill rack, grill potatoes, covered, over        medium heat 5 minutes. Add chicken kabobs; grill until        chicken is no longer pink and potatoes are tender, 10-15        minutes, turning skewers occasionally.                In a large bowl, whisk lemon juice, pepper & remaining        salad dressing. Add romaine, chicken, potatoes, onion        and cheese; toss to coat.                Melissa Adams, Tooele, Utah                Makes: 2 servings                RECIPE FROM: https://www.tasteofhome.com                Uncle Dirty Dave's Archives               MMMMM              ...
